Wheel width and offsets question
If I wanted to go 265/35/18 square(yes, I am considering going widebody in the front), what width (I presume 9.5?) and what offsets for the front (pretty clear that ET58 is proper for the rear in this configuration, unsure on the front). Thx!

You will need to have an offset of absolutely no higher than a +30 on a 9.5" wheel in the front - that will be extremely close to the strut and depending on your tire choice, might rub the strut. Something like a +25 is a bit of safer fitment from an inboard perspective. This all goes to assume you have correctly moved the coilover spring above the tire (so something in the 6-7" total length range).

Just for your reference, the rims for my "race setup" are 17x9 50 mm offset with a 12.5mm spacer up front. I run a 255-40 RE71R, have 3.3* front camber and have a slight rub on a hard bump, nothing while racing. There's a few mm clearance between the tire and Koni shock body. I could probably get a 265 without modifying the front fenders but would need about 4* camber which would probably be to much. I have the same springs as you but have a 1/2" spacer on the front and rear to raise the car 1/2".
